Rock Spring Tree Trek: 11AM, Rock Spring Pond Trailhead
Step into the forest on a guided hike at Westmoreland State Park that shows how trees are everything but still, even in the winter!
We will be hiking ~0.5 miles down a paved trail to Rock Spring Pond. Strollers and leashed furry friends are welcome. Please wear weather appropriate clothes and bring your water bottles.
CCC Hike: 12:30 PM, Rock Spring Pond Dam
Did you know that Westmoreland is one of the original State Parks in Virginia? Come join us on a guided hike, learning all about the Civilian Conservation Corp, their time building up Westmoreland, and the imprint of their hard work still here today!
We will be hiking for ~1.5 miles on pavement, decking, gravel, and hardpack trail with roots. Please make sure to wear weather appropriate clothing and bring your water bottles! To get to the rock spring pond dam, you must hike ~0.5 miles from rock spring pond trailhead.
Fossil Quest: 3:00 PM, Big Meadows Trailhead
Why can we find fossils at Westmoreland State Park and where did they come from? Hike with a ranger down the Big Meadow trail to Fossil Beach and learn about the natural history of Westmoreland State Park, millions of years in the making.
This hike to Fossil Beach is a 1.2-mile round trip on a trail with roots and relatively steep terrain, where you can see what the tide has brought in for us to find. Meet at the Trail head of Big Meadow Trail. Leashed furry friends are welcome. Please dress appropriately for the weather and wind along the shore.

Acerca de las caminatas del primer día
Cada año, el 1de enero, los Parques Estatales de Virginia celebran caminatas del primer día. Esta iniciativa nacional invita a las personas a recibir el año nuevo conectándose con la naturaleza y creando recuerdos duraderos en un parque estatal. Se ofrecen caminatas de primer día dirigidas por guardabosques y autoguiadas en todo el estado, lo que brinda a los visitantes de todas las edades y niveles de habilidad la oportunidad de explorar al aire libre. El 1 de enero es un día de estacionamiento gratuito en todos los parques estatales de Virginia. (Todavía se aplica la tarifa de admisión en Natural Bridge).
